PROFESSIONAL EXPERIENCE:

Confidential, Odenton, MD

Senior Oracle Database Administrator

Responsibilities:

  • Rewrote and implemented a backup strategy following company SLA; execution of backup schedule for both physical and logical backups using RMAN and DATAPUMP utilities respectively. I also used block change tracking (BCT) which reduced backup time from 8hrs down to 45mins.
  • Deployed Database security policy and installation, using passwords, privileges and user profiles, Used Oracle Transparent Data Encryption to encrypt columns, tables and Tablespaces, I also implemented the “triple A” (AAA) and database auditing policies as well as data redaction.
  • Managed database security by creating, assigning appropriate roles & privileges to users depending on user activity, auditing, & performing other security related tasks including Transparent Data Encryption.
  • Cloned databases using RMAN and DATAPUMP utilities for all database sizes.
  • Extensively used AWR, ADDM, ASH, and Explain plan for periodic Performance tuning.
  • Monitored AWR, ADDM, ASH, Alert log, dynamic performance views, DBMS STATS, Trace Files, and System Event Logs for unusual events & took appropriate action according to company policies of incident reports.
  • Experience migrating database objects from development through test & into production environments.
  • Capacity planning (supported 3 tier architecture, planning of tables, indexes, tablespaces and databases) to allow for growth potential and analyze data growth trends for capacity and resources.
  • Installed and administered Oracle Physical Standby Database for single and multiple instances to achieve high availability and DR solution (DATA GUARD).
  • Capacity planning to meet the demands of the dynamic aspects of storage & memory for the databases.
  • Performed database Refreshes from production environments.
  • Implement table and index partitioning so as to Minimize DB time, increase disk load balancing, improve query speed and enable faster parallel query
